Tv Academy to boost AI with lawmakers: ‘We wish to give attention to its moral use’

The Tv Academy has lengthy existed to have a good time business excellence, handing out Emmy Awards every fall.

However the North Hollywood-based group has been branching out. Dramatic shifts in tv platforms, manufacturing and know-how — together with the fast adoption of synthetic intelligence — have spurred the nonprofit group to spice up its position advocating for its various membership by taking a deeper have a look at public coverage that impacts the business.

Tv Academy Chairman Cris Abrego and Chief Govt Maury McIntyre have traveled to Washington this week to fulfill with lawmakers to debate potential laws on AI. The journey marks the academy management’s first main foray into lobbying.

Writers, actors and different artisans are involved about the usage of AI, fearing cost-conscious corporations will flip to automated pc packages to wipe out jobs. The 2023 labor strikes stretched for months because the Writers Guild of America and the Display Actors Guild-American Federation of Tv and Radio Artists pushed studio chiefs so as to add artist protections.

“Television is being impacted,” McIntyre mentioned in an interview.

The problem comes because the Tv Academy is attempting to broaden its mission to higher serve its practically 30,000 members, not simply the fortunate few who take dwelling the trophy of a winged lady lifting an atom. The statuette was designed within the early years of the Area Age, greater than 70 years in the past when tv was the upstart medium roiling the Hollywood studio institution.

Abrego, a veteran actuality present producer who has led the academy for the final 12 months, and McIntyre are scheduled to fulfill with California Democratic Sen. Alex Padilla, just lately elected Rep. Laura Friedman (D-Glendale) and Texas Democratic Rep. Joaquin Castro . Additionally they plan to go to workers members of Sen. Todd Younger (R-Ind.), Sen. Mike Rounds (R-S.D.) and California Republican Rep. Jay Obernolte.

Tv Academy CEO Maury McIntyre, left, and Chairman Cris Abrego have traveled to Washington this week to fulfill with lawmakers. The journey marks the academy management’s first main foray into lobbying.

(Tv Academy)

The interview was edited for size and readability:

Media corporations, commerce teams and unions already foyer in Washington. What’s the objective of your journey?

McIntyre: We signify all points of tv. There are points that have an effect on our members that we will method in a very nonpartisan method. AI [is] impacting our members considerably, and so they want a voice as a result of they aren’t being represented proper now. We’re completely specializing in points that influence all of our members and representing them in a nonpolitical method.

How is the academy approaching AI and the challenges introduced by it?

Abrego: This business has lengthy embraced know-how. We wish to be on the desk to determine methods to finest deliver AI into our business as a software that helps us create extra content material. And we wish to be aware to guard folks’s people rights in order that they [can] create their artwork.

What’s your benchmark for fulfillment for this journey?

Abrego: We wish to make an influence so [lawmakers] know the academy can deliver added worth to their technique of writing laws. We sit in a singular place of listening to from our members — stunt folks to visible results to make-up artists and administrators. We’re not a union or a manufacturing firm, however we wish to create worth for our membership, and we’re a part of the worldwide financial system.

Is the academy additionally advocating for measures to attempt protect L.A.’s manufacturing financial system?

Abrego: A hundred percent. A majority of our membership resides right here in California, and it’s essential that manufacturing comes again. It is a huge effort, however one begins on the state degree.
